Do Not Call Laws: Protecting Citizens from Unwanted Texts

telemarketer

In many regions, including Mississippi, citizens have the right to privacy and protection from unwanted communication, especially in the form of spam text messages. This is where the "Do Not Call" laws come into play, specifically targeting telemarketers and law firms that engage in unsolicited text messaging. These laws are designed to prevent businesses from bombarding consumers with promotional texts, ensuring a peaceful and undisturbed digital environment.

By registering their numbers on the national Do Not Call Registry, Mississippi residents can ensure they won't receive marketing or sales messages from various entities, including law firms. This registry acts as a powerful tool for law enforcement to track and investigate repeated violations of spam text laws, holding offenders accountable for disrupting the peace and quiet of citizens' lives.

Enforcing Anti-Spam Measures: A Step-by-Step Guide

telemarketer

Law enforcement plays a pivotal role in combating spam text messages, especially when it involves repeated violations of anti-spam laws.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how they enforce these measures:

1. Identification and Monitoring: Law enforcement agencies employ advanced technologies to identify patterns and sources of spam texts. They monitor communication networks, tracking suspicious activity and recurring offenders. This involves analyzing call records, SMS logs, and other digital footprints left by spammers.

2. Investigation and Verification: Once a potential spammer is identified, authorities conduct a thorough investigation. This includes verifying the source of the messages, tracing back the phone numbers, and gathering evidence of non-consensual contact. They may also interview witnesses or victims to understand the impact of the spamming activities.

3. Legal Action and Notifications: Based on the findings, law enforcement can take various legal actions. They may issue formal warnings to violators, especially if it’s their first offense. For repeated offenders in Mississippi, Do Not Call laws are strictly enforced, leading to fines or even criminal charges. Authorities also notify affected individuals about the violation, empowering them to take further action against spammers.

4. Collaboration and Information Sharing: To effectively combat spamming, law enforcement agencies collaborate with telecommunications companies and internet service providers. They share information, strategies, and best practices, creating a unified front against cybercriminals. This collaborative approach helps in identifying emerging trends and adapting anti-spam measures accordingly.
